The Shiloh Generals will face off against the Lakeside Vikings at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Shiloh has been getting the ball to fall more lately as they've increased their point totals each of their last three games.
Last Thursday, Shiloh came up short against Chamblee and fell 56-49. That's two games in a row now that the Generals have lost by exactly seven points.
Meanwhile, Lakeside played a tough match on Tuesday in which they were outscored in every quarter. They had to suffer through a 75-47 loss at the hands of Tri-Cities. While losing is never fun, the Vikings can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Georgia basketball rankings (they are ranked 382nd, while the Bulldogs are ranked 16th).
Shiloh will need focus on slowing down Nate Bennion, one of several Lakeside players who made an impact when they last played. He posted seven points and seven rebounds. Another player making a difference was Shaan Fritz, who put up 11 points and five assists.
Lakeside's loss dropped their record down to 3-10. As for Shiloh, they have been struggling recently as they've lost seven of their last eight games, which put a noticeable dent in their 5-12 record this season.
Shiloh barely slipped by Lakeside when the teams last played back in December of 2024, winning 43-42. Does Shiloh have another victory up their sleeve, or will Lakeside tur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
